An APK or .exe file claiming to be a free FRP tool could be a trojan horse. Malware like keyloggers and reverse proxy tunneling tools can be installed on your system, giving attackers access to your computer and personal data.
– Even if the tool works, it might silently collect your contacts, messages, browsing history, or device identifiers and send them to a remote server. This happens because the tool requires broad permissions to operate.

Factory Reset Protection is a built‑in Android security feature automatically activated when a Google account is registered on a device. If a factory reset is performed outside the device’s settings menu, the system demands the previously used Google account credentials before allowing setup to continue.
